The Administrative Executive will be responsible to the Centre Leader for all administrative details related to the day-to-day operations of the centre and provide customer care services to students and their parents during their stay with the school.
Job Roles & Responsibilities
Administration:
Support the centre with data entry of child transactions into Little Lives and ECDA CMS system. This includes:
Child Transactions: Enrolment, Withdrawal, Transfer, Change of Program, Student Pass Application, Promotion of Children
Subsidy applications in CMS for all new and existing cases
Update of school fees changes in CMS at child level (yearly)
Update of vacancy status in CMS
Retrieval of documents for audit purpose
Handles queries from existing and new parents and provide support whenever needed
Liaise with both external and internal stakeholders such as ECDA subsidy officers, licensing officers, financial assistance officers to facilitate and resolve enrolment and subsidy/financial assistance application issues
Responsible for proper storage of stationary and uniforms
Perform general clerical duties
Support operational work flow
Upkeeping of children’s P file
Enrolment:
Maintaining a waiting list, calling parents up for enrolment when a vacancy arises
Follow up with parents on the documents needed for enrolment
Planning of orientation sessions for new enrolment
Finance:
Issuing of ad-hoc invoices, e.g. first-time payment, uniforms purchase etc
Checking of monthly fee invoices
Creating of monthly GIRO deduction listing, updating of monthly payment
GSII monthly reconciliation
Adding the correct subsidies discount for each child
Follow-up on discrepancies for any over-payment or under-payment of subsidy as well as subsidies adjustments in CMS
Petty cash handling
Customer Service
Meet and greet parents, students and visitors at the school
Provide proper information about school fees and programs
Handle calls/emails/walk-ins enquiries from existing and new parents
Taking charge of the centre’s inbox
Procurement
Purchase items from suppliers for capital expenditures, kitchen, stationery, events, etc Prepare Expenditure Requisition Forms and obtain price quotations from suppliers
